- At BYDFi, we believe that changes in the fed fund rate can have both short-term and long-term implications for cryptocurrency investors. In the short term, sudden changes in interest rates can create volatility in the cryptocurrency market, leading to price fluctuations. However, in the long term, the impact of the fed fund rate on cryptocurrencies may be less significant compared to other factors such as regulatory developments, technological advancements, and market sentiment. It's important for investors to consider a holistic approach and not solely rely on the fed fund rate when making investment decisions in the cryptocurrency market.
